Safe storage of standard seeds

The standard sample seed is a physical standard for indoor seed purity testing. If a well-proven standard sample with consistent morphological characteristics and strong viability is not properly preserved, it will lead to distortion of the standard sample, reduced viability, and thus to seed purity. Inspection brings difficulties. Pre-storage Selection and Treatment of Standard Seeds According to the characteristics of different crop varieties, dry seeds with the botany characteristics, typical genetic traits, full grain, healthy maturity, and vigor of the varieties are selected as the standard, and then the standard seeds are selected. Clean, remove impurities, imperfect grains and seeds with virus, and dry the seeds or dried naturally by artificial low temperature (below 40°C) to control the moisture content of the standard seeds within the safe water content, thereby prolonging the storage life and storage. Methods include: Drying The clean and dry standard seeds are placed in paper bags or cloth bags and placed in brown glass bottles or iron boxes. A layer of anhydrous calcium chloride or silica gel is placed on the bottom of the container and is equivalent to the amount of seeds. Lime and other desiccants, or equivalent to the number of seeds 2 to 3 times the dry grass ash can also be stamped and sealed, kept in a cool, dry place, drying each year, and replace the desiccant, using the method can be marked Samples are safely stored for 2 to 3 years or more. Simple sealed method: The dry standard seeds are first wrapped in toilet paper or cloth bag, and then put into pots or brown glass bottles, then covered and sealed, set at low temperature, dry, ventilated place (or 4 °C ~ 6 °C refrigerator) Can be stored for a long time. Hanging method The dry standard seeds are put into a black double bag and hanged in the sample room or standard sample cabinet to keep the room or cabinet dry, cool, ventilated, free from direct sunlight and pest free. The seeds are safely stored for 3 to 5 years. Ears, pods, and fruits are used to carry air-dried standard seeds with spikes, ribbons, and fruit in nylon Gauze bags, suspended in a standard sample room, and stored in a cool, ventilated, cool, dark place. This method is commonly used for the storage of crop seed samples such as corn, wheat, rapeseed, soybeans, and peanuts. The method can fully ripen the seeds, and can protect their morphological characteristics will not change, while allowing the ears to fully dry, to avoid the impact of environmental temperature and humidity mutations on the seed, generally safe storage for more than 2 years. The seed samples of different crop types have different storage methods, and should be scientifically selected during storage so that the stored standard seeds can maintain their morphological characteristics and viability for as long as possible to ensure their use value.
